Orange River Kayaking

Orange River kayaking offers an exciting adventure along South Africa’s longest river, which forms a natural border with Namibia. Starting in the Richtersveld area, the experience takes you through stunning landscapes, including towering cliffs, rocky gorges, and vast desert vistas.

The river features a mix of calm sections and occasional rapids, with varying levels of difficulty depending on the route and time of year. Kayakers can choose from different routes, including multi-day trips that allow for camping along the riverbanks.

The Orange River is rich in wildlife, with opportunities to spot bird species like fish eagles and kingfishers, as well as animals such as antelope and baboons. The experience also offers moments of leisure, with chances to swim, explore hidden coves, and enjoy the serenity of nature.

Guided tours are recommended for safety, providing equipment, expert guidance, and insights into the area’s natural and cultural history. Whether you’re an experienced kayaker or a beginner, kayaking on the Orange River promises a memorable and peaceful outdoor adventure.
